Specification | Umidigi F1 | Huawei Honor 10 Lite |
---|---|---|
Rear Camera | 16 MP + 8 MP with autofocus | 13 MP f/1.8 (Wide Angle) 2 MP f/2.4 (Depth Sensor) with autofocus |
OS | Android v9.0 (Pie) | Android v9.0 (Pie) |
Display | 6.3 inches, 1080 x 2340 pixels | 6.21 inches, 1080 x 2340 pixels |
Battery | 5150 mAh | 3400 mAh, Li-Po Battery |
RAM | 4 GB | 4 GB |
Price | ₹11,627 | ₹12,999 |
